Vacuum impregnation seals porosity in castings. Our process includes:
- Vacuum removal of air from pores.
- Introduction of sealant under pressure.
- Curing the sealant.
- Creating leak-tight components.

Vacuum Impregnation seals porosity in castings and powder metal parts, preventing leaks and improving reliability. The process fills internal voids with sealant, ensuring pressure-tight components.
Essential for castings, powder metal parts, and pressure applications, vacuum impregnation ensures leak-free, reliable components.
